Abstract
It the utility model is related to a kind of intelligent multi output microminiature electromagnetic relay, including bottom plate, the shell being arranged on bottom plate, it is multiple to be spaced the electromagnetic assembly being arranged on bottom plate, described electromagnetic assembly includes the bobbin being arranged on bottom plate, iron core, coil, the yoke being arranged on bobbin, place is arranged on the insulation board on yoke between corresponding yoke and coil, the armature being arranged on yoke, the movable contact spring set with armature linkage, the static contact being fixed at the movable contact of corresponding movable contact spring on bottom plate, the terminal pin being arranged on bottom plate, a L-shaped connecting plate is provided with described bottom plate, the connecting plate includes long plate portion and minor plate part, long plate portion is connected on the movable contact spring of each electromagnetic assembly, minor plate part is fixed on bottom plate, and there is the plug division being exposed at outside bottom plate on minor plate part.The utility model have simple in construction, install convenient, small volume, it is stable and reliable for performance the advantages of.

Technical field
It the utility model is related to a kind of electromagnetic relay, and in particular to a kind of intelligent multi output microminiature electromagnetic relay.
Background technology
Electromagnetic relay is a kind of using extensive electronic component, and it is applied to household electrical appliance, automobile, Industry Control, electricity
The fields such as Force system, communication device.At present, the miniature relay that in the market is used to be arranged in smart home is using multiple small
Type electromagnetic relay arranges installation in the circuit board respectively, so as to realize the function of multi output, although the miniature electro-magnetic relay
Can realize the function of multi output, but the miniature electro-magnetic relay exist inconvenient, temperature rise is installed, performance is unstable lacks
Fall into.

The beneficial effect of said structure is:The electromagnetic relay by the way that multiple electromagnetic assemblies are arranged on a bottom plate,
Each electromagnetic assembly is connected by connecting plate, multiple electromagnetic assemblies are integrated into a module with multi output function, subtracted significantly
The small volume of the electromagnetic relay, and while disclosure satisfy that user's multi output functional requirement, it is easy to user installation again, and should
Electromagnetic relay also has the advantages of simple in construction, temperature rise is low, stable and reliable for performance.
Especially, insulation barrier is installed with the bobbin of described one of electromagnetic assembly, the insulation barrier should
The coil of electromagnetic assembly and the minor plate part of connecting plate are separated.By being provided with one between the minor plate part and coil of connecting plate
Individual insulation barrier, the creep age distance between connecting plate and coil is increased, improve the reliability of electromagnetic relay work.
